Getting started with Kaltura
15 Sep 2021

Getting started with Kaltura

by nathanghall | Posted in: Uncategorized | 0

What is Kaltura? Kaltura is a video hosting service we have access to at Douglas College. It works in a similar way that YouTube does, but it is hosted in Canada and has a number of security features that restrict … Continued
